Sign-on bonus $5,000 POSITION OVERVIEW The School Psychologist is responsible for providing evaluation, consultative, and counseling services in the school setting. Conduct psycho-educational evaluations and lead the multidisciplinary team in the process of identifying students as eligible for and in need of special education services.

  • Lead the multidisciplinary evaluation team (MET) through the evaluation process when a student is referred for a special education evaluation.
  • Complete comprehensive evaluations and use professional judgment in order to identify areas that need additional data collected.
  • Participate in Legacy Traditional School non-violent crisis response team if trained.
  • Conduct classroom observations as part of the special education evaluation process, child study team (CST) process and consultative process.
  • Prepare cohesive and timely evaluation reports.
  • Interpret assessment data and impart it to parents and MET members in a meaningful way.
  • Identify students’ needs and develop programming recommendations based on evaluation outcomes.
  • Lead the school team in the development and implementation of behavior plans.
  • Lead the school’s pre-referral intervention team.
  • Provide counseling services in alignment with student’s IEPs and/or 504 plans.
  • Provide school-based counseling in accordance with pre-referral intervention or informally.
  • Facilitate training on topics related to position on an as-needed basis.
  • Provide consultative services to teachers and administrators regarding behavioral and academic concerns.

  • Master’s or higher degree.
  • School Psychologist Certificate in the state position is located.
  • The incumbent in this position will be required to pass a criminal history background check.
  • Experience conducting psycho-educational evaluations.
  • Knowledge of IDEA and K-8 programming for special education.
